British space scientists and engineers will today submit detailed plans for a mission to help divert an asteroid which could collide with Earth in 2036. Apophis, a 240-mile wide remnant of the early solar system believed to be made mainly of rock, circles the Sun in an orbit that brings it close to the Earth every few years. It will pass within 22,400 miles of our planet in 2029 - closer than the satellites used in our communication systems.
